Florida Adjuster License: Decoding the 5-20, 6-20, and Other FL Adjuster Licenses

For Florida residents athirst about acquiring or poring over extra concerning the Florida claim agent license, it could be useful to take out and simplify the multitude of license classes and kinds which can be accessible. This will assist guarantee basically the most environment friendly path to acquiring exactly what you need by basically the most direct means accessible.

At the broadest degree, there are three normal Florida claim agent license classes - the 6 sequence, the 5 sequence, and the three sequence.

The 6 Series - Company Adjuster Licenses

The 6 sequence refers to license varieties which can be held by Company claim agents. What is a Company claim agent? The Florida Dept. of Financial Services defines a Company claim agent as "any soul employed on an insurer's staff of claim agents or completely closely-held subsidiary of the insurer". In different phrases, an worker of an coverage firm - a "staff "claim agent because the place is typically referred to as. And with a purpose to qualify for this license sort, you'll clearly should be employed by an organization. The following 6 sequence varieties, which can be mentioned at size beneath, can be found - 6-20, 6-44, 6-21, 6-24.

The 5 Series - Independent Adjuster Licenses

The 5 sequence refers to license varieties which can be held by Independent claim agents. Independent claim agents are claim agents who're "self-employed or associated with or employed by an independent adjusting firm or other independent claim agent". Note that an unbiased claim agent could also be an worker, still arrivederci as you power be an worker of an adjusting agency quite than an coverage firm instantly, you power be even so thought-about to be an unbiased. Most claim agents athirst about dealing therewith notably profitable kind of claims succeeding from ruinous occasions (e.g. Hurricane Wilma), could be looking one of many 5 sequence licenses. Also noteworthy, in contrast to the 6 sequence, you do not want to be employed or narrowed for work on the time you apply for the license. Like the 6 sequence, the next varieties can be found - 5-20, 5-44, 5-21, 5-24 (detailed rationalization of every beneath).

The 3 Series - Public Adjuster License

The Three sequence refers to license varieties held by Public claim agents. Public claim agents are flatly whole different from both Company or Independent claim agents in that they intend the insured quite than the insurer. FLDFS defines a Public claim agent as follows:

...any one who for cash, fee, or any factor of worth, prepares, completes, or recordsdata an coverage declare type for an insured or third-party claimant or who for cash, fee, or other factor of worth, acts or aids in any method on behalf of an insured or third-party claimant in negotiating for or effecting settlement of a declare or claims for loss or injury lined by an coverage contract or who advertises for employment as an claim agent of such claims, and in addition contains any one who, for cash, fee, or other factor of worth, solicits, investigates, or adjusts such claims on behalf of any such public claim agent.

Public claim agent licensing and license compliance is dealt with in a different way than Company and Independent licensing and, notably, requires you to be secure previous to licensure. At the time of this writing, you should full a yr drawn-out Apprenticeship (license sort T31-20) after which go the state examination to earn a full Three sequence license.

As the three sequence of licenses are a special breed, we'll deal entirely from right here on with the 5 and 6 sequence claim agent licenses. Let's get a load at the categories:

All-Lines: 6-20, 5-20

The 6-20 and 5-20 are each All-Lines licenses. All-Lines is precisely what it feels like - each line of coverage. The 5-20 Independent and 6-20 Company All-Lines licenses qualifies you to deal with the total vary of claims for Auto, Property & Casualty, & Workers Compensation.

Property & Casualty: 6-44, 5-44

The -44s consult with the Property & Casualty claim agent license varieties. Property & Casualty would go with act and industrial property and legal responsibility claims still would exclude Auto, Health, and Workers Comp.

Auto: 6-21, 5-21

The -21s consult with Auto and particularly Motor Vehicle Physical Damage and Mechanical Breakdown. If you propose to focus entirely on dealing with claims for injury completed to automobiles as a consequence of accidents and climate occasions (e.g. hail), then that is your license.

Workers Comp: 6-24, 5-24

The -24s consult with Workers' Comp claims adjusting. Workers' Comp claim agents decide advantages to be awarded to staff burned inside the office.

Which Florida License Should You Get and How?

First, decide the sequence. If you have simply joined an coverage firm as a salaried worker, then only follow with their lead for which 6 sequence license to use for. If, nevertheless, you wish to break into the unbiased aspect and both are or are unremarkably not employed or narrowed to work as such, search for one matter inside the 5 sequence. There is not any motive to not apply to your 5-20 claim agent license as its simply as simple to acquire because the 5-44, 5-21, or 5-24. It offers you the best flexibility to search out your claims area of interest with out limitation.

If you first receive a 5 sequence license after which receive full-time employment standing with an coverage firm, it is possible for you to to change your license standing to the 6 sequence by way of a comparatively easy course of that doesn't require additive examination or coursework.

Bottom Line:

Whichever of the 5 or 6 sequence licenses you select to pursue, there are a number of Florida accepted Designations (on-line or classroom) that permit you to instantly receive licensure with out additive examination or coursework. Such Designations will unremarkably intend the fastest and surest means to get the suitable Florida claim agent license for you.
